Company
Overview
Founded with a vision to lead in building systems solutions, Modern Niagara has grown to be a trusted name in the construction and engineering industry.
With expertise spanning mechanical, electrical, and plumbing systems, the company specializes in providing integrated solutions for complex projects.
Their portfolio includes landmark projects across various sectors, from high-rise buildings and corporate offices to hospitals and universities.
Modern Niagara thrives in delivering customized services for residential, commercial, and industrial clients, offering tailored solutions to meet unique demands.
Their innovation in energy-efficient systems has positioned them as a forward-thinking leader in sustainable building technology.
The company has completed large-scale projects in sectors such as energy, utilities, and residential, highlighting its versatile approach to diverse challenges.
Known for its ability to manage complex, multi-phase projects, Modern Niagara remains committed to delivering high-quality, cost-effective solutions.
